>         I can't find the right mailing list to get on for 
> this.  The only ones I found at apache.org are the announce mailing 
> lists.  Anyway, I use up2date on RHEL to keep my apache updated 
> Apache 2.0.52.  I need to turn off SSL and have apache only run on 
> port 81.  I believe that I have fixed it to run only port 81, and 
> can find nothing in the httpd.conf file for port 443 to turn 
> off.  There also is no mod_ssl module being loaded either.  So How 
> do I turn it off without recompiling?  I have port 80 and 443 being 
> used by tomcat and this is why I need to turn off port 443 in 
> apache and change the port 80.

Never mind.  It is in the /etc/httpd/conf.d/ssl.conf file
